Reverse osmosis systems are widely used in various industries to purify water and remove contaminants. This technology relies on a semi-permeable membrane to separate impurities from water, producing clean and pure water. However, over time, the membrane can become fouled with impurities, reducing its efficiency and affecting the quality of the treated water. To prevent this from happening, regular cleaning and maintenance of the reverse osmosis system are essential. This is where reverse osmosis cleaning chemicals play a crucial role.

reverse osmosis cleaning chemicals are specially formulated solutions designed to effectively clean and restore the performance of reverse osmosis membranes. These chemicals are essential for removing foulants, scale, and other impurities that can accumulate on the membrane surface over time. By using the right cleaning chemicals, you can prolong the life of your reverse osmosis system and ensure that it operates at peak efficiency.

There are several types of reverse osmosis cleaning chemicals available on the market, each with its own unique formulation and intended use. Some of the most common types include:

1. Acidic Cleaners: Acidic cleaners are used to remove scale and mineral deposits from the membrane surface. These cleaners are typically formulated with citric acid, hydrochloric acid, or phosphoric acid, which work effectively to dissolve and dislodge stubborn deposits. Acidic cleaners are essential for preventing scaling, which can significantly reduce the performance of the reverse osmosis system.

2. Alkaline Cleaners: Alkaline cleaners are used to remove organic foulants, bacteria, and other contaminants from the membrane surface. These cleaners are formulated with surfactants and chelating agents that help disperse and remove organic matter. Alkaline cleaners are essential for maintaining the cleanliness of the reverse osmosis membrane and preventing biofouling.

3. Oxidizing Cleaners: Oxidizing cleaners are used to remove stubborn biological fouling and organic contaminants from the membrane surface. These cleaners typically contain chlorine, peracetic acid, or hydrogen peroxide, which have strong oxidizing properties that can effectively kill bacteria and disinfect the membrane surface. Oxidizing cleaners are essential for preventing bacterial growth and maintaining the purity of the treated water.

4. Antiscalants: Antiscalants are used as a preventive measure to inhibit the formation of scale and mineral deposits on the membrane surface. These chemicals work by sequestering calcium, magnesium, and other scaling ions, preventing them from precipitating and forming deposits. Antiscalants are essential for protecting the reverse osmosis membrane from scaling and ensuring long-term performance.

When choosing reverse osmosis cleaning chemicals, it is important to consider the specific needs of your system and the type of fouling that needs to be removed. Some cleaning chemicals are more suited for certain types of fouling than others, so it is essential to select the right product for optimal results. Additionally, it is important to follow the manufacturer’s instructions for dilution, contact time, and rinsing procedures to ensure the effectiveness of the cleaning process.
